I've never heard about such thing. I have no experience of any kind on Brigham pipes. Could it be that it isn't actually stained but finished with some other method (coloured wax or varnish etc). Properly stained and dried item, be it pipe or any other, shouldn't leave no color.
I've seen that on two pipes, one was my friend's Brigham, the other was my Vander Elst. But it only left staining on pipe cleaners, not on the hand while smoking.
